Sumary
Safety devices for protection against excessive pressure - Part 10 : sizing of safety valves and bursting discs for gas/liquid two-phase flow

This document specifies the sizing of safety valves and bursting discs for gas/liquid two-phase flow in pressurized systems such as reactors, storage tanks, columns, heat exchangers, piping systems or transportation tanks/containers, see Figure 2. The possible fluid states at the safety device inlet that can result in two-phase flow are given in Table 1.

NOTE          The pressures used in this document are absolute pressures, not gauge pressures.
